Ayush Admissions Central Counseling Committee, AACCC is responsible for conducting Ayush counselling for All India Quota (AIQ) seats for undergraduate and postgraduate courses. AACCC of the Ministry of AYUSH, Government of India, executes online counselling for 15% AIQ seats in government-aided institutes, central universities, national institutes, private colleges, and 100% seats in deemed universities.
Candidates will have to fill out their choices of colleges and courses as per their preferences and lock them in before the last date. Along with Ayush NEET counselling for courses such as BAMS, BUMS, BHMS, BSMS and BYNS, the authority also conducts counselling for PG AYUSH courses such as MD, MS and PG Diploma. Aspirants can check the important guidelines of eligibility criteria for AYUSH courses. Below is the list of Ayush NEET counselling points.
10+2 or equivalent with Physics, Chemistry, Biology/Biotechnology, and English as a core subject in both Classes 11 and 12 from a recognized board.
The minimum pass percentage of 50% for general category (40% for reserved candidates) is required.
The minimum age limit is 17 years of age.
Candidates must have qualified NEET UG.

The following eligibility criteria guidelines for postgraduate candidates are discussed below.
Aspirants must have a valid BAMS/BHMS/BUMS/BSMS degree from a recognised institute.
AYUSH graduates should have completed a one-year rotatory internship before the last date.
A provisional/permanent registration certificate of BAMS/BUMS/BHMS/BSMS issued by CCIM/ CCH/ state board, university, or Deemed university is mandatory.
Candidates must have qualified AIAPGET exam
The application form of undergraduate and postgraduate Ayush courses is released online. The registration form is released on the official website, aaccc.gov.in. The qualified candidates need to fill the registration form by entering all the relevant information required for the application process. Upload all the scanned copies of documents as per the specifications prescribed by the authorities. The applicants need to pay the fee online using credit/debit cards, net banking and UPI. After the successful payment, candidates can download the confirmation page for future reference.
The NEET qualified candidates are eligible for the NEET AYUSH counselling. AYUSH NEET counselling is conducted for 15% All India Quota seats to grant admission to Ayurveda, Unani, Siddha, and Homeopathy courses. The remaining 85% state quota seats will be granted by respective state counselling authorities. The aspirants need to fill in their preferences for colleges and courses along with the registration during the NEET ayush counselling.
The AIAPGET qualified candidates will be eligible for AACCC PG counselling. The aspirants will be granted admission to postgraduate courses such as MD/MS/PG Diploma in Ayush courses based on the rank secured in AIAPGET, college they wish to apply for, availability of seats, and other factors. The AACCC will prepare a list of seat allocation post choice filling sessions. After being allocated a seat, candidates must submit their original documents to the allotted institute within the stipulated time.
Check the following documents which are required for AYUSH counselling.
Class 10 mark sheet
Class 12 mark sheet
A valid ID proof
Caste certificate (if applicable)
Disability certificate (if applicable)
The following documents required for AIAPGET counselling:
AIAPGET result
Permanent/Provisional Registration Certificate issued by CCIM/State Medical Council
High school/higher secondary certificate/birth certificate
A valid photo ID proof
AIAPGET result
Mark Sheets of BAMS/BUMS/BSMS/BHMS
BAMS/BUMS/BHMS/BSMS Degree Certificate
Internship Completion Certificate
Caste/community Certificate
